WebOct 12, 2024 · Bacterial Pneumonia . Bacterial pneumonia is spread from person to person by coughing, sneezing, and close contact in general. These bacteria are so easy to pass, they can spread to another person before the first person starts showing symptoms. If … dwayne johnson movie the game planWebPneumonia is inflammation of the lungs, usually caused by an infection. Most people get better in 2 to 4 weeks, but babies, older people, and people with heart or lung conditions are at risk of getting seriously ill and may need treatment in hospital.
